Is agent B the seller's agent? To me, it is impossible that he/she could represent you without a buyer agent agreement. Typically, the whole commission is 5% - 6% of house value, and the buyer agent and the seller agent will get half each.

You are legally bound to agent A. Sounds to me that he/she has some ethical issue. If you already signed a 3-month agreement with that agent and the agreement has not expired yet, why he/she asked you to sign another one, worse worse, no expiration date?

If I were you, I would try to understand both buyer agreements you signed to see which one is a valid one. I am more concerned about the second one. Try to consult your local realtor organization and get some legal advice.
